KEY RESPONSIBILITIES



  • The Director General (DG) hires and supervises any paid office staff of the chamber, subject to approval by the board, and coordinates all volunteer office workers to execute the directives of the board of directors and the National President.

  • The DG develop and execute a comprehensive strategic plan aligned with the goals and objectives of the Chamber.

  • The DG shall be responsible for the maintenance, security and proper recording of the organizations records and assets as required by law and made available as when required by authorized persons; including items loaned, rented or hired.

  • The DG shall act as custodian of minutes, updating resolution and ordinance books in accordance with retention, and oversee filling minutes of any meeting and in an appropriate filling system.

  • The DG shall attend all meetings of the company; represent the organization in external events where necessary and as directed by the board.

  • The DG and/or any member of the staff of the chamber as he may direct shall be made available on request to committee chairmen to be secretary to any committee or sub-committee.

  • The DG shall maintain company committee member lists for: Board of Directors, Executive Committee, Education/Literacy Workforce Development Committee, Military Affairs Committee, Legislative Affairs Committee, Membership/Small Business Committee and other committee meetings as required.
